    Abstract: A twin clutch having two clutch discs between a flywheel and a pressure plate and having an intermediate plate between the two clutch discs. In an engaging operation of the clutch, a flywheel-side clutch disc is first held between the intermediate plate and the flywheel, and a pressure-plate-side clutch disc is then held between the pressure plate and the intermediate plate.

    Abstract: In a push-type clutch, a facing wear adjustment nearly annular adjust ring with which an outer peripheral part of a diaphragm spring contacts from a side opposite to a flywheel is screwed into an inside face of a pressure plate so as to be movable in a clutch axial direction, so that a worm wheel is rotated by a bracket moving in a clutch axial direction to rotate the adjust ring when a facing is worn out. The adjust ring position can thus be adjusted automatically to a diaphragm spring side by a wear amount of the facing.

    Abstract: A shift limiting valve (110) driven by a control solenoid valve controlled by an electronic control means (40) is installed between a manual shift valve (50) working in cooperation with speed-change operation of driver and shift valves (60) and (62) driven by solenoid valves (S1) and (S2) controlled by the electronic control means (40). The control solenoid valve is controlled by the electronic control means (40) to actuate the shift limiting valve (110) when a vehicle is moving forward at a specified or higher speed so that a planetary gear transmission (12) is not changed to a reverse drive stage even if the driver changes a drive mode to the reverse drive stage.
